Boosting your gut microbiome with antioxidants: Why it matters now
Antioxidants combat oxidative stress and microbial dysbiosis, promoting a healthy gut microbiome. The review highlights how antioxidants enhance microbial diversity and gut barrier integrity. Berries, leafy greens, citrus fruits, nuts and green tea are top sources. Incorporating probiotics, prebiotics and high-fiber foods supports gut health. Avoiding sugar, stress and smoking helps maintain a balanced microbiome. […]

The unspoken realities of menopause’s most common symptoms
Hot flashes, experienced daily by 87% of menopausal women, originate in the brain due to a hypersensitive hypothalamus reacting to dropping estrogen levels. The symptom is a full-body neurological event, often involving heart palpitations, chills, anxiety and a subsequent wave of fatigue, not just heat. Amino acid taurine may extend life and enhance health, studies show
Taurine levels decline with age in mice, monkeys and humans. Taurine supplementation in middle-aged mice increased their lifespan by 10-12%. Supplementation improved health parameters, including bone mass, muscle endurance and immune function. Human studies show higher taurine levels are associated with better health outcomes.
